Q: Is 6,386,133 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 6,386,133 is a composite number.

Why is 6,386,133 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 6,386,133 can be evenly divided by 1 3 13 39 373 439 1,119 1,317 4,849 5,707 14,547 17,121 163,747 491,241 2,128,711 and 6,386,133, with no remainder.

Since 6,386,133 cannot be divided by just 1 and 6,386,133, it is a composite number.
